**New in Django development version**
In some rare cases, you might wish to pass parameters to the SQL fragments
in ``extra(select=...)```. Since the ``params`` attribute is a sequence
and the ``select`` attribute is a dictionary, some care is required so
that the parameters are matched up correctly with the extra select pieces.
Firstly, in this situation, you should use a
``django.utils.datastructures.SortedDict`` for the ``select`` value, not
just a normal Python dictionary. Secondly, make sure that your parameters
for the ``select`` come first in the list and that you have not passed any
parameters to an earlier ``extra()`` call for this queryset.
This will work::
Blog.objects.extra(
select=SortedDict(('a', '%s'), ('b', '%s')),
params=('one', 'two'))
... while this won't::
# Will not work!
Blog.objects.extra(where=['foo=%s'], params=('bar',)).extra(
select=SortedDict(('a', '%s'), ('b', '%s')),
params=('one', 'two'))
In the second example, the earlier ``params`` usage will mess up the later
one. So always put your extra select pieces in the first ``extra()`` call
if you need to use parameters in them.
